Re: Redstone Membership Help


@Varsity_Lu wrote:

I'm going to Huntsville for a few days this month and am wondering if there is anything I can do while I'm there to become eligible for Redstone FCU membership.  Can I join an organization? Become a member of zoo or museum? Anything?


anybody can join for free through a free AUSA membership and you don't need to apply in person to join

 

you can't get the visa signature unless you reside in AL/TN though
